G

GODSON 2020
Review of Holiday Inn JFK

3 years ago

Hotel is nice but the grounds need some work. The ...

Hotel is nice but the grounds need some work. The tree and shrubs are over grown that it make it look that management is not keeping the property up Landscaping is need ASAP!!!!

Comments:

No comments